No.

Cubic numbers are found by multiplying a numbers by itself three times.

E.g. 2 x 2 x 2 = 8 so 8 is a cubic number.

The closest cubic numbers to 38 are 27 (3 x 3 x 3) and 64 (4 x 4 x 4).

How do you convert cubic yards in cubic inches?

Multiply the number of cubic yards by 46,656 (or divide it by 0.00002143) in order to get the number of cubic inches in the same volume. Multiply the number of cubic inches by 0.00002143 (or divide it by 46,656) in order to get the number of cubic yards in the same volume.


Convert cubic feet to yards?

To convert cubic feet to cubic yards, you need to divide the number of cubic feet by 27 since there are 27 cubic feet in a cubic yard. So, to convert cubic feet to cubic yards, divide the number of cubic feet by 27.
